Count() & Remove() Fungerar i MongoDB med exempel

MongoDB Count() Funktion

Konceptet med aggregering är att utföra en beräkning av resultaten som returneras i en fråga. Anta till exempel att du ville veta hur många dokument som finns i en samling enligt den fråga som skickades. MongoDB tillhandahåller funktionen count().

Exempel på MongoDB Count() Funktion

Låt oss titta på ett exempel på detta.

db.Employee.count()

Kodförklaring:

  • Ovanstående kod utför räknefunktionen.

Om kommandot utförs framgångsrikt kommer följande utdata att visas

Produktion:

Exempel på MongoDB Count() Funktion

Utgången visar tydligt att 4 dokument finns i samlingen.

Utföra ändringar

De två andra verksamhetsklasserna i MongoDB är uppdateringen och ta bort uttalanden.

Uppdateringsoperationerna tillåter en att modifiera befintliga data, och borttagningsoperationerna tillåter radering av data från en samling.

Remove() Funktion i MongoDB

In MongoDB, den db.collection.remove() metod används för att ta bort dokument från en samling. Antingen kan alla dokument tas bort från en samling eller bara de som matchar ett specifikt villkor.

Om du bara utfärdar kommandot remove kommer alla dokument att tas bort från samlingen.

Exempel på MongoDB Remove() Funktion

Följande kodexempel visar hur man tar bort ett specifikt dokument från samlingen.

db.Employee.remove({Employeeid:22})

Kodförklaring:

  • Ovanstående kod använder borttagningsfunktionen och specificerar kriterierna som i detta fall är att ta bort de dokument som har anställds-id som 22.

Om kommandot utförs framgångsrikt kommer följande utdata att visas

Produktion:

Exempel på MongoDB Remove() Funktion

Utdata kommer att visa att 1 dokument har ändrats.